Constructively, I propose to include in Emacs a new mode
(with a name like 'modern-mouse-mode') where
- down-mouse-3 and mouse-3 pop up the context menu
containing at least the items "Cut", "Copy", "Paste", "Undo", "Redo"
(and only "Copy" when the buffer is in read-only mode);
- holding down the Shift key while using mouse-1 adjusts
the already active region;
- dragging the active region moves it to the place
where the mouse-1 was released;
- dragging the active region copies it to another place
while holding down the Control key;
- holding down the Shift key while scrolling with mouse wheel
scrolls the buffer horizontally;
